Description

The southern boundary of the site is formed by the rear garden of a Grade II listed building. A number of non-designated heritage assets have been identified beyond the site boundary. Otherwise the assessment has identified no heritage assets of sufficent significance that might present future development of the site. However, while there is at present insufficent information to accurately judge the archaeological potential of the site, there is a slight potential for prehistoric/Roman features.
